The problem with cold-email testing

Everyone runs A/B tests. Few produce evidence.

Cold email is too important to optimize through opinions, premature winner badges, and tactics copied from somebody else’s audience.

01

Tests stop when they look good

Most campaigns choose a winner before the planned sample is reached, turning ordinary noise into a new playbook rule.

02

Too many variables change

A new subject, opening, offer, and CTA launch together. Even when results improve, nobody knows what caused it.

03

Replies are treated equally

An out-of-office reply and a meeting request both count as replies. The metric moves while the business outcome stays hidden.
